4,294,995,936 is a composite number, even.
4,294,995,936 (four billion two hundred ninety-four million nine hundred ninety-five thousand nine hundred thirty-six) is an even 10-digit number. It is a composite number with 192 divisors, and factors as 2⁵ × 3 × 7 × 11 × 31 × 18,743. Its proper divisors sum to 10,215,559,200,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x100006FE0.
